Firstly, his sub-par passive, Mercy. 10% increased basic attack damage to movement impaired enemies. Pretty boring, yeah? So you slow an enemy and you do 10% more damage with an auto attack. Whoop-de-freakin'-do.

How about this? Talon was, or rather, is still an Assassin, correct? (If you don't reply yes, you need to go talk to Doctor Shen.) So, how about something that ties to his past? According to lore on him, Talon took targets that Marcus gave to him, yes? Give Talon a name, a picture and a time frame, and he'll go along his merry way to mercilessly stab the victim at hand. So, why not use something like this for Talon now? Besides, he was never really a merciful type, was he? I mean, stabbing people for the sake of finding the man who beat you senseless in an alleyway of dank Noxus isn't that merciful, right?


[Passive] Hit Target
**Talon acquires a target at the beginning at the game, randomly from his enemies. They will not know they're being targeted. Talon gains bonuses for doing damage to, and killing the target. Talon's damage increases to his target as they grow lower and lower in health.

Talon receives a 'hit' on an enemy champion. (Sanctioned by Baron Nashor & Friends)
Talon gains an extra 10 movespeed when approaching his target.
Talon gains an extra 10% dodge after doing damage to his target, lasts 2 seconds.
Talon deals an extra 1% damage to them for every 3% HP they have lost.

Upon killing his target, Talon is given a 'Completed Contract' which can either be consumed to grant a permanent 2 armor penetration, or redeemed for gold.

[Q] Noxian Diplomacy Basically the same thing, without the damage on the bleed. Moved it to Lacerate.

[W] Rake Talon throws 3 daggers in a cone in an area. They go through things and slow, and hit twice when they return to Talon. Ew.

[W] Lacerate Talon throws a knife at an enemy. The knife stays inside the target, granting vision and doing light DoT (does NOT disrupt Recall), until Talon either retrieves it via auto-attacking, or until they recall. If Talon rips the blade out of his the enemy, they bleed for 100% Talon's bonus AD for an additional 3 seconds, although it does not give vision. Noted that it's a bad idea. Sorry.

[E] Cutthroat Talon basically slows, marks and teleports to a target. Nice skill.

[E] Shadowstep Talon fades into the shadows, instantly appearing behind his target, and does extra damage to them for 3 seconds. In addition, Talon will dodge the first spell/basic attack after casting to his target.
